1. 第一步安装Nodejs,没有安装的可以去http://nodejs.cn/下载安装 node -v 检查安装版本
2. 安装truffle
Npm install –g truffle
3. 安装testrpc
Testrpc自带10个用户账户主要用于truffle调试
Npm install –g ethereumjs-testrpc
4. 接下来我们就可以创建项目了
Truffle init webpack
由于新版本truffle引入了box的概念,所有的示例代码都以box的形式提供。因此我们不需要用truffle init命令
Truffle unbox metacoin
5. 编译项目
truffle compile
6. 部署合约
truffle migrate
再次部署
truffle migrate --reset
7. 启动服务
truffle serve
truffle console控制台
然后打开 http://localhost:8080/ 即可对刚才的truffle工程调试了
本文介绍了如何通过Truffle快速搭建智能合约开发环境,包括Node.js的安装、Truffle及testrpc的配置,创建并编译项目,以及部署和调试合约的具体步骤。
1905

被折叠的 条评论
为什么被折叠?



